/*
 * establish: create a listening socket on a port. you need to call
 * accept() when it's connected.
 * portnum is the port number to bind to.
 * returns your fd
 */

faim_internal int aim_listenestablish(u_short portnum)
{
#if defined(__linux__) /* XXX what other OS's support getaddrinfo? */
  int listenfd;
  const int on = 1;
  struct addrinfo hints, *res, *ressave;
  char serv[5];
  sprintf(serv, "%d", portnum);
  memset(&hints, 0, sizeof(struct addrinfo));
  hints.ai_flags = AI_PASSIVE;
  hints.ai_family = AF_UNSPEC;
  hints.ai_socktype = SOCK_STREAM;
  if (getaddrinfo(NULL/*any IP*/, serv, &hints, &res) != 0) {
    perror("getaddrinfo");
    return -1;
  }
  ressave = res;
  do {
    listenfd = socket(res->ai_family, res->ai_socktype, res->ai_protocol);
    if (listenfd < 0)
      continue;
    setsockopt(listenfd, SOL_SOCKET, SO_REUSEADDR, &on, sizeof(on));
    if (bind(listenfd, res->ai_addr, res->ai_addrlen) == 0)
      break; /* success */
    close(listenfd);
  } while ( (res = res->ai_next) );
  if (!res)
    return -1;
  if (listen(listenfd, 1024)!=0) {
    perror("listen");
    return -1;
  }
  freeaddrinfo(ressave);
  return listenfd;
#else 
  int listenfd;
  const int on = 1;
  struct sockaddr_in sockin;
  
  if ((listenfd = socket(AF_INET, SOCK_STREAM, 0)) < 0) {
    perror("socket(listenfd)");
    return -1;
  } 
  if (setsockopt(listenfd, SOL_SOCKET, SO_REUSEADDR, (char *)&on, sizeof(on) != 0)) {
    perror("setsockopt(listenfd)");
    close(listenfd);
    return -1;
  }
  memset(&sockin, 0, sizeof(struct sockaddr_in));
  sockin.sin_family = AF_INET;
  sockin.sin_port = htons(portnum);
  if (bind(listenfd, (struct sockaddr *)&sockin, sizeof(struct sockaddr_in)) != 0) {
    perror("bind(listenfd)");
    close(listenfd);
    return -1;
  }
  if (listen(listenfd, 4) != 0) {
    perror("listen(listenfd)");
    close(listenfd);
    return -1;
  }

  return listenfd;
#endif
}

faim_export int aim_oft_checksum(char *buffer, int bufsize, int *checksum)
{    
  short check0, check1;
  int i;
  
  check0 = ((*checksum & 0xFF000000) >> 16);
  check1 = ((*checksum & 0x00ff0000) >> 16);

  for(i = 0; i < bufsize; i++) {

    if(i % 2)  { /* use check1 -- second byte */
      if ( (short)buffer[i] > check1 ) { /* wrapping */
	
	check1 += 0x100; /* this is a cheap way to wrap */

	/* if we're wrapping, decrement the other one */
	if(check0 == 0) /* XXX: check this corner case */
	  check0 = 0x00ff;
	else
	  check0--;			
      }

      check1 -= buffer[i];
    } else { /* use check0 -- first byte */
      if ( (short)buffer[i] > check0 ) { /* wrapping */
	
	check0 += 0x100; /* this is a cheap way to wrap */

	/* if we're wrapping, decrement the other one */
	if(check1 == 0) /* XXX: check this corner case */
	  check1 = 0x00ff;
	else
	  check1--;			
      }

      check0 -= buffer[i];
    } 
  }

  if(check0 > 0xff || check1 > 0xff) { /* they shouldn't be able to do this. error! */
    faimdprintf(2, "check0 or check1 is too high: 0x%04x, 0x%04x\n", check0, check1);
    return -1;
  }
  
  check0 &= 0xff; /* grab just the lowest byte */
  check1 &= 0xff; /* this should be clean, but just in case */

  *checksum = ((check0 * 0x1000000) + (check1 * 0x10000));

  return *checksum;
}
